Mercedes-Benz has dropped some of the camo on their CLS-Class facelift prototypes being driven around Europe. In this single spyshot of the updated CLS-Class, the tape on the front bumper has been removed, revealing a better view of how the car will look like.
This particular car must be wearing an AMG Sport kit as the front bumper looks similiar to the AMG Sport bumper found on the E-Class (found on the E 400 in Malaysia). The revised front bumper is complemented by a reshaped grille, with a single bar running through the middle.
There are big changes to the interior as well, with the dashboard revised to use a floating tablet style COMAND display, which allows for larger screen sizes to be used. It looks like save for the W222 S-Class, Mercedes-Benz will be using this new style for the COMAND display for all of its new cars, including the facelifts, as we’ve seen this revision in spyshots of the M-Class SUV facelift as well.
